Paint Vs. Stain: How To Identify And Differentiate The Two

is there away to tell paint from stain

Distinguishing between paint and stain can be a nuanced task, as both are commonly used to enhance the appearance of surfaces, yet they serve different purposes and have distinct characteristics. Paint, typically opaque, forms a solid layer over a surface, providing a complete color change and often offering protective benefits against elements like moisture and UV rays. Stain, on the other hand, is semi-transparent or transparent, designed to penetrate the surface material—such as wood or concrete—to highlight its natural texture and grain while adding color. Key differences include application method, finish appearance, and durability, making it essential to understand these properties to identify whether a surface has been painted or stained.

Visual Differences: Compare sheen, texture, and color depth between paint and stain finishes

Paint and stain finishes differ visually in sheen, texture, and color depth, offering distinct aesthetic and functional qualities. Sheen, the reflective quality of a surface, is a key differentiator. Paint typically provides a uniform sheen that can range from flat to high-gloss, depending on the product. Flat paint absorbs light, creating a matte appearance ideal for hiding imperfections, while semi-gloss or gloss paints reflect light, adding brightness and durability. Stain, on the other hand, enhances the natural sheen of the material it’s applied to, such as wood, often resulting in a softer, more muted luster. This difference in sheen allows paint to dominate a surface visually, whereas stain subtly complements it.

Texture is another critical visual distinction. Paint forms a solid, opaque layer that can be smooth or textured depending on application techniques, such as brushing, rolling, or spraying. Textured paint finishes, like those achieved with a roller or trowel, add dimensionality but obscure the underlying material. Stain, however, penetrates the surface, preserving the natural texture of wood grain or other porous materials. This transparency allows the material’s unique patterns and imperfections to remain visible, creating a more organic, tactile finish. For example, a stained wooden deck will showcase its grain, while a painted deck will appear uniform, masking the wood’s character.

Color depth varies significantly between paint and stain due to their application methods and opacity. Paint offers a wide range of colors and can completely transform a surface, providing consistent, opaque coverage. This makes it ideal for bold statements or concealing flaws. Stain, however, enhances the natural color of the material with translucent pigments, resulting in a richer, more nuanced hue. For instance, a dark walnut stain deepens the tone of wood while allowing its natural variations to show through. Paint’s color depth is uniform and surface-level, whereas stain’s depth is inherent, tied to the material’s absorption and character.

To distinguish between the two, consider these practical tips: Examine the sheen—if it’s uniformly reflective or matte, it’s likely paint. If the luster appears natural and varies with the material, it’s probably stain. Run your hand over the surface—if you feel the material’s texture, stain is the culprit; a smooth or artificially textured layer suggests paint. Finally, observe color depth—if the hue is consistent and opaque, paint was used. If the color seems integrated into the material with visible variations, stain is the finish. Application Methods: Examine how paint and stain are applied to surfaces differently

Paint and stain application methods diverge significantly, each tailored to achieve distinct finishes and effects on surfaces. Paint, typically applied in thicker coats, aims to create a uniform, opaque layer that conceals the underlying material. Stain, conversely, penetrates the surface, enhancing the natural grain and texture of wood or other porous materials. This fundamental difference dictates not only the tools used but also the techniques employed.

Consider the tools: Paint application often involves brushes, rollers, or sprayers designed to distribute pigment evenly. For instance, a 3-inch synthetic bristle brush is ideal for cutting in edges, while a roller covers large areas efficiently. Stain, however, is best applied with natural bristle brushes, pads, or rags, which allow for better absorption into the material. For example, a lambswool applicator is recommended for oil-based stains to ensure smooth, even penetration. The choice of tool directly impacts the final appearance, with paint favoring consistency and stain prioritizing depth.

Technique plays a critical role in distinguishing the two. Paint is usually applied in multiple coats, with drying times between layers—typically 2 to 4 hours for latex paint, depending on humidity and temperature. Each coat builds opacity and durability. Stain, on the other hand, is often applied in a single, generous coat, followed by immediate wiping to remove excess and ensure even absorption. For example, a wood deck might require a stain application with a back-brushing technique to avoid pooling and promote uniform color.

Practical tips further highlight these differences. When painting, start with a primer to enhance adhesion and coverage, especially on bare wood or drywall. Stain, however, requires a clean, dry, and often sanded surface to ensure proper penetration. For vertical surfaces like walls, paint is applied in a "W" or "M" pattern to minimize lap marks, while stain is best applied in the direction of the grain to accentuate natural patterns. Durability Factors: Assess longevity and resistance to wear in paint versus stain

Paint and stain differ fundamentally in their composition and application, which directly impacts their durability. Paint, typically a blend of pigments, binders, and solvents, forms a thick, opaque layer that adheres to surfaces. Stain, on the other hand, contains dyes or pigments dissolved in a carrier that penetrates wood fibers, enhancing rather than concealing the natural grain. This structural difference means paint acts as a shield, while stain works as a tint, influencing how each withstands wear over time.

To assess longevity, consider the environment where the finish is applied. Paint excels in high-traffic areas or exteriors exposed to harsh weather due to its protective barrier. For instance, exterior latex paint can last 5–10 years before requiring touch-ups, depending on climate and sun exposure. Stain, particularly oil-based varieties, offers UV resistance but may fade or wear faster in direct sunlight, typically lasting 2–5 years on decks or siding. For interior surfaces, paint’s durability is evident in its ability to resist scuffs and stains, making it ideal for walls and trim in busy households.

Resistance to wear varies based on the type of stress the finish endures. Paint’s solid film provides superior protection against abrasion, moisture, and temperature fluctuations. For example, semi-gloss or high-gloss paints are more durable than flat finishes, as their smoother surfaces repel dirt and clean easily. Stain, while less resistant to physical wear, excels in flexibility, allowing wood to expand and contract without cracking. This makes stain a better choice for wooden decks or furniture where movement is natural and frequent.

Practical tips can maximize the durability of both finishes. For paint, ensure surfaces are clean, dry, and primed to promote adhesion. Apply at least two coats, allowing proper drying time between layers. For stain, prepare wood by sanding and cleaning to open pores for better absorption. Reapply stain every 1–2 years in high-wear areas to maintain protection. Both finishes benefit from regular maintenance, such as cleaning and inspecting for damage, to extend their lifespan.

Surface Penetration: Analyze how paint sits on surfaces while stain absorbs into them

Paint and stain interact with surfaces in fundamentally different ways, and understanding this distinction is key to identifying which you’re dealing with. Paint, by design, forms a film on top of the material it’s applied to. This film can be thick or thin, depending on the number of coats and the paint’s viscosity, but it remains a distinct layer. Stain, on the other hand, penetrates the surface, embedding pigments and binders into the substrate itself. This absorption alters the material’s color without creating a separate layer. To test this, lightly sand a small area: paint will flake or chip off, while stain will reveal the same color beneath the surface, as it’s become part of the material.

Analyzing surface penetration reveals not only the nature of the finish but also its durability and maintenance requirements. Paint’s surface-level adherence makes it more susceptible to wear, chipping, and peeling over time, especially in high-traffic areas or environments with moisture. Stain, because it integrates with the material, tends to last longer and fade more gracefully. For example, a stained wooden deck will show signs of aging through uniform color lightening, whereas a painted deck will likely develop visible cracks and flakes. This difference underscores why stains are often preferred for porous materials like wood, while paint is chosen for smoother, non-porous surfaces like metal or drywall.

If you’re unsure whether a surface has been painted or stained, a simple visual and tactile inspection can provide clues. Paint often has a uniform, opaque appearance, and you may notice brush strokes or a slight texture depending on the application method. Stain, however, typically enhances the natural grain or texture of the material, resulting in a more translucent and varied finish. Running your hand over the surface can also help: paint may feel smooth or slightly raised, while stained surfaces retain the original texture of the material. For a more definitive test, apply a small amount of paint thinner or acetone to an inconspicuous area—paint will soften or dissolve, while stain will remain unchanged.

Practical considerations for choosing between paint and stain depend on the desired aesthetic and the material’s porosity. For instance, if you want to conceal imperfections or achieve a bold, uniform color, paint is the better option. However, if you aim to highlight natural features like wood grain or stone texture, stain is ideal. When applying stain, ensure the surface is clean and free of sealants, as these can block absorption. For paint, proper surface preparation—sanding, priming, and cleaning—is critical to ensure adhesion. Maintenance Needs: Compare cleaning, repair, and reapplication requirements for paint and stain

Paint and stain demand distinct maintenance approaches, each with its own rhythm and requirements. Paint, a robust shield, typically lasts 5-10 years before needing reapplication, depending on exposure and quality. Stain, more translucent and penetrative, often requires reapplication every 2-5 years, especially on horizontal surfaces like decks where UV exposure and foot traffic accelerate wear. This fundamental difference in longevity dictates the frequency of your maintenance calendar.

Paint's maintenance leans towards repair and touch-ups. Minor scratches or chips can be addressed with a small brush and matching paint, blending seamlessly if done promptly. Stain, however, often requires full reapplication for repairs, as patching can be visibly uneven due to its translucent nature and potential color variation over time.

Cleaning methods diverge significantly. Paint's smooth, non-porous surface allows for more aggressive cleaning with mild detergents, pressure washing (at a safe distance to avoid chipping), and even light scrubbing for stubborn stains. Stain, being more delicate and absorbent, demands gentler care. Pressure washing should be avoided, as it can strip the stain and damage the wood. Opt for a soft brush, mild soapy water, and a gentle rinse.

For reapplication, paint requires thorough surface preparation: sanding to create a rough surface for adhesion, priming if necessary, and multiple coats for optimal coverage. Stain, while also requiring cleaning and sanding, often needs less extensive preparation due to its thinner consistency and ability to penetrate the wood.

Ultimately, the choice between paint and stain hinges on your desired aesthetic, the level of maintenance you're willing to commit to, and the specific demands of the surface you're treating. Paint offers longer-lasting protection with less frequent reapplication but requires more meticulous repair. Stain provides a natural wood look with easier initial application but demands more frequent touch-ups and gentler cleaning.
